Understanding Materials in Long Sleeve Running Shirts

When selecting a long sleeve running shirt, the material plays a crucial role in performance and comfort. Different fabrics serve various purposes:

Synthetic Fabrics

Synthetic materials, such as polyester and nylon, are popular choices for performance shirts. They offer moisture-wicking properties, helping to keep you dry during intense workouts. These fabrics dry quickly and are often lightweight, making them ideal for high-energy runs.

Merino Wool

Merino wool is an excellent choice for colder conditions. It provides natural insulation, breathability, and moisture management. Unlike some synthetics, merino wool is soft against the skin and resists odors, making it suitable for longer runs without frequent washing.

Blends

Many brands offer shirts made from blends of materials, combining the best features of each. For example, a cotton-polyester blend can provide comfort and breathability, perfect for casual runs or everyday wear.

Key Features to Look for in Long Sleeve Running Shirts

Choosing the right long sleeve running shirt involves understanding various features that enhance the running experience. Here are some important features to consider:

Moisture Management

Look for shirts with moisture-wicking technology, which helps pull sweat away from your skin. This feature is essential for maintaining comfort during runs, especially in hot or humid conditions.

Breathability

Breathable fabrics allow air circulation, keeping you cool while you run. Mesh panels or ventilated designs can enhance breathability in performance shirts.

Fit and Comfort

The fit is crucial for comfort. Look for shirts that offer a snug yet flexible fit, allowing for a full range of motion without feeling restrictive. Many brands, such as those available at www.runningwarehouse.com and www.adidas.com, provide various fits, including regular and athletic.

If you often run in low-light conditions, consider shirts with reflective elements. These features increase visibility, making you safer while running at dawn or dusk.

UV Protection

For outdoor runners, UV protection is a valuable feature. Shirts designed with UV-blocking materials help protect your skin from harmful sun rays, particularly during long runs.

FAQ

What is the best material for long sleeve running shirts?
The best material depends on your needs. Synthetic fabrics like polyester are great for moisture management, while merino wool offers warmth and breathability for colder conditions.

How do I choose the right fit for a long sleeve running shirt?
Look for a snug yet flexible fit that allows for a full range of motion. Consider trying on different sizes and styles to find what feels most comfortable for you.

Are long sleeve running shirts suitable for warm weather?
Yes, many long sleeve running shirts are designed with breathable materials and moisture-wicking properties, making them suitable for warm weather as well.

How can I maintain my long sleeve running shirts?
Wash your shirts in cold water and avoid fabric softeners to preserve moisture-wicking properties. Air drying is recommended to prevent shrinkage and damage.

Do I need to wear a base layer under a long sleeve running shirt?
It depends on the temperature and your preference. In colder weather, a base layer can provide additional warmth, while in milder conditions, a long sleeve shirt alone may suffice.

What features should I look for in a winter running shirt?
Look for thermal insulation, moisture-wicking properties, and features like thumbholes or high collars for added warmth.

Are reflective elements necessary for night running?
Yes, reflective elements enhance visibility in low-light conditions, making them an important safety feature for night running.

How do I know if a running shirt has UV protection?
Check the product description or label for terms like “UV protection” or “UPF rating,” which indicates how well the fabric protects against harmful rays.
